Traveling from Cherryvale to Hilton Head Island covers 157.7 miles across the South Carolina landscape. You can comfortably complete this trip in about 3 hours and 10 minutes, making it an ideal day trip that doesn't require an overnight stay. Your journey will primarily utilize I-95, Manning Road, and Coosaw Scenic Drive to reach the coast. Budgeting approximately $25 for fuel should cover your transit costs for the trip. Since both the origin and destination are located within the Southeast region, you will experience a consistent regional feel as you transition from the inland areas toward the Atlantic coast.

Seasonal Notes
Summer travel usually means heavier construction, hotter rest stops, and busier weekend traffic around major cities.
Winter travel shortens daylight, so a route that looks manageable on paper can feel much longer after dark.
Holiday weekends tend to make both departure and arrival windows slower than the raw route time suggests.
